Can a Grown Man Ride a 24 Inch Bike?

While a grown man can physically propel a 24-inch bicycle, it is generally not recommended for regular use due to significant ergonomic, biomechanical, and safety limitations that compromise comfort, efficiency, and long-term joint health.

Understanding Bike Sizing and Wheel Diameter

When discussing a "24-inch bike," the primary reference is almost always the diameter of the wheel. This measurement is crucial because it dictates many aspects of a bicycle's geometry, including frame size, standover height, and component proportions. Bikes with 24-inch wheels are predominantly designed for children, typically those between 8 and 12 years old, or roughly 4'5" to 5'0" (135-150 cm) in height. Adult bicycles, in contrast, typically feature wheel diameters of 26 inches, 27.5 inches (650b), 29 inches (700c for mountain bikes), or 700c (for road bikes and hybrids), all of which are paired with frames designed to accommodate the adult human physique.

Biomechanical and Ergonomic Challenges

Attempting to ride a 24-inch bike as an adult male presents a multitude of biomechanical and ergonomic issues:

  • Cramped Riding Position: The most immediate and noticeable problem is the severely compromised riding posture. An adult male's longer limbs will necessitate an excessively flexed position at the knees, hips, and elbows. This hunched-over, compressed posture places undue stress on the spine, neck, and shoulders.
  • Inefficient Power Transfer: Proper pedaling mechanics require adequate leg extension. On a 24-inch bike, even with the seat post at its maximum height, a grown man will struggle to achieve the necessary leg extension. This leads to inefficient power transfer, as the rider cannot fully engage their glutes, hamstrings, and quadriceps through their optimal range of motion. The shorter crank arms often found on children's bikes further exacerbate this inefficiency, reducing leverage.
  • Increased Joint Stress: The repetitive motion of pedaling in an overly flexed position significantly increases compressive and shear forces on the knee and hip joints. Over time, this can contribute to patellofemoral pain syndrome, hip impingement, and lower back discomfort. The lack of proper extension also prevents muscles from working optimally, leading to quicker fatigue and potential strain.
  • Handling and Stability: Smaller wheels generally offer less gyroscopic stability at speed compared to larger wheels. This can make the bike feel "twitchy" and less predictable, especially over rough terrain or at higher velocities. Additionally, the smaller wheels are less effective at rolling over obstacles, translating more impact directly to the rider. An adult's higher center of gravity relative to the small bike further compounds these stability issues.
  • Weight Distribution: Achieving optimal weight distribution over the front and rear wheels is crucial for bike control. On a bike that is too small, an adult rider will find it difficult to properly distribute their weight, potentially leading to a feeling of being "over the bars" or too far back, compromising steering and braking.

Safety Concerns

Beyond discomfort and inefficiency, riding an undersized bicycle poses significant safety risks:

  • Reduced Control and Maneuverability: The compromised riding position and inherent instability of a small bike under an adult rider diminish control, particularly during quick maneuvers, braking, or navigating obstacles.
  • Visibility in Traffic: A lower riding position can make an adult cyclist less visible to motorists, increasing the risk of accidents, especially in urban environments.
  • Component Durability: Components on children's bikes, including the frame, wheels, handlebars, and brakes, are designed for the lighter weight and lower forces exerted by a child. An adult male can easily exceed these design limits, leading to premature wear, component failure, or even structural damage, which can be catastrophic.
  • Braking Effectiveness: Braking systems on children's bikes are often less powerful and may not be sufficient to safely stop an adult male, particularly at speed or on descents.

When Might It Be "Possible" (with Caveats)?

While not recommended for practical use, there are extremely limited scenarios where a grown man might technically "ride" a 24-inch bike:

  • Very Short, Occasional Rides: For instance, moving a child's bike a few feet, or a very brief, low-speed novelty ride (e.g., in a backyard). This should not involve any significant distance or effort.
  • Specialized Niche Bikes: It's important to differentiate between a standard "24-inch kids bike" and adult-specific bikes that might utilize 24-inch wheels. Some highly specialized adult BMX, dirt jump, or folding bikes might feature 24-inch wheels, but these are purpose-built with robust frames and components designed for adult loads and specific riding styles. These are not general-purpose bicycles and are explicitly designed to accommodate adult riders, unlike a typical child's 24-inch bicycle.
  • Extremely Short Stature Adults: For men of exceptionally short stature, a highly customized adult-specific frame might rarely be paired with 24-inch wheels, but even then, 26-inch wheels are far more common for adult-specific small frames. These are specialized solutions, not a typical child's bike.

Choosing the Right Bike Size for Adults

For optimal comfort, performance, and safety, adult men should always choose a bicycle that is appropriately sized for their body. Key considerations include:

  • Frame Size: This is the most critical factor, determined by standover height (distance from the ground to the top tube, with feet flat on the ground) and reach (distance from the saddle to the handlebars).
  • Wheel Size: While wheel size influences ride characteristics, it's typically chosen based on the type of riding (e.g., 700c for road, 29er for mountain biking, 27.5 for versatility) and then paired with an appropriate frame size.
  • Professional Bike Fit: For serious riders or those experiencing discomfort, a professional bike fit is invaluable. A fitter can adjust saddle height, fore-aft position, handlebar height and reach, and cleat position to optimize biomechanics, power output, and comfort while minimizing injury risk.
  • Test Ride: Always test ride a bike before purchasing to ensure it feels comfortable and manageable.
